ABOUT Regina Catholic Education Center:
Regina Catholic Education Center is a Catholic school located in Iowa City, Iowa educating students from PreK through 12th grade. The school is supported by four Catholic parishes: St. Thomas More,
St. Patrick, St. Mary, and St. Wenceslaus. Regina Catholic Education Center “is committed to preparing tomorrow’s leaders through a comprehensive educational experience focused on excellence and anchored in the teachings of the Roman Catholic Church.”

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
1. Oversee financial operations of the school including payroll, employee benefits, purchasing, insurance, and building and grounds.
2. Coordinate tuition collection, tuition communications with families, and the financial assistance program
3. Create and monitor budgets, monitor actual results, and complete monthly variance analysis
4. Provide management reports monthly and on-demand
5. Establish and monitor profitability metrics to analyze the school’s operations, providing information to the Head of School and Finance Committee for consideration
6. Assist the Diocesan Accounting Office with their review of internal controls and provide all materials and documentation required for the audit
7. Acquire information needed from the Diocese of Davenport to compute the parish assessment numbers and submit to the parishes for approval
8. Ensure all expenditures are consistent with established Board of Education policies and in compliance with generally accepted accounting principles by the Diocese of Davenport
9. Ensure compliance with applicable federal and state regulations for financial, payroll, and tax matters
10. Perform other duties as assigned
11. Attend Board of Education meetings for reporting purposes
12. Work collaboratively with the Foundation
QUALIFICATIONS:
1.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or Business preferred with a minimum of 5 years accounting experience or 5+ years relevant experience. CPA desirable, but not required.
2. Solid understanding of financial statements, accounting, and financial analysis
3. Proficient in Excel, Word, Power Point, Google Suite and Quickbooks
4. Attention to detail and positive can-do attitude a must
5. Ability to tolerate peak workloads and multiple assignments. Produce results with accuracy and reliability.
6. Ability to initiate action and work independently
